Types of Child Care
There are several kinds of childcare readily available near me, including daycare facilities, home-based care, and preschool programs. Daycare centers are typically large services that may accommodate many young ones, while home-based treatment providers run out of their own domiciles. Preschool programs are designed to prepare kiddies for preschool and past, with a focus on very early education and socialization.
Every type of childcare possesses its own advantages and disadvantages. Daycare facilities provide a structured environment with qualified staff and educational tasks, nonetheless they may be costly and might have long waiting listings. Home-based attention providers offer a more individualized and versatile strategy, but may not have the exact same standard of supervision as daycare facilities. Preschool programs supply a very good educational foundation for the kids, but may possibly not be suited to all families because of cost or place.
